OSTEOPATHS
Sholeh Fadami DO is the owner of the Ealing Optimum Health Clinic. She graduated from the British School of Osteopathy in 1989 and is registered with the General osteopathic council (GOsC). She has an interest in treating sports injuries and was the resident osteopath at Holmes Place ports club in Ealing for many years. She was also one of the onsite osteopaths for American football teams in this country. She is registered with the General Osteopathic Council.
Amedea Incorvaia DO graduated from the British College of Osteopathic Medicine in London, qualifying her as a GOsC registered Osteopath and as a Naturopath. Whilst working in her graduate year, along with treating a range of conditions of all ages, Amedea's interest started to gear towards pregnant women and children. Amedea works with women to prepare them for conception, pregnancy and labour. All these are approached through diet, lifestyle advice, specific exercises and Osteopathic manipulative therapy.
